Peppermint Cream Fudge
- 1 1/2 teaspoons butter, softened (no substitutes)
- 2 ounces cream cheese, softened
- 2 cups confectioners' sugar
- 3 tablespoons baking cocoa
- 1/2 teaspoon milk
- 1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1/4 cup chopped nuts
- Peppermint Layer
- 2 ounces cream cheese, softened
- 2 cups confectioners' sugar
- 1/2 teaspoon milk
- 1/2 teaspoon peppermint extract
- 1/4 cup crushed peppermint candies
- 1. Line the bottom and sides of an 8 x 4 x 2 inch loaf pan with foil.
- 2. Grease foil with 1 1/2 t.
- 3. butter; set aside.
- 4. In a small mixing bowl, beat cream cheese.
- 5. Gradually beat in confectioners' sugar, cocoa, milk and vanilla.
- 6. Stir in the nuts.
- 7. Spread into prepared pan.
- 8. Chill for 1 hour or until firm.
- 9. For peppermint layer, beat cream cheese in a small mixing bowl.
- 10. Gradually beat in confectioners' sugar, milk and extract.
- 11. Stir in peppermint candy.
- 12. Spread evenly over chocolate layer.
- 13. Chill for about one hour or until firm.
- 14. Using foil, lift fudge from pab.
- 15. Gently peel off foil.
- 16. Cut into squares.
